Job Summary
Plan, layout, weld, install, test and repair all types of pipe and similar tubular products in accordance with plans, specifications, codes, and industry standards. Work with other crafts as instructed by supervision. Regular attendance with flexible hours including overtime, weekends, and holidays. Review layouts/blueprints/diagrams; complete welds to specifications; install and verify operation of high-pressure steel pipes and fittings; fabricate/install metal fittings; use hand and power tools; test installed piping systems; set up welding equipment (arc, gas-shielded arc, submerged arc, or gas welding). Successful 6G stainless steel, carbon steel weld coupons; ABS certification required. Safety, ethics, and environmental rules followed; shipyard environment with rigorous safety procedures; ability to read blueprints and plans; communicate effectively with supervisors and employees.
Required Qualifications
- High school diploma or GED equivalence
- 3-5 years pipe welding experience
- Working knowledge of welding equipment and techniques for pipe welding
- X-ray pipe welding experience and ability to weld pipe in all positions
- Knowledge of welding symbols, ship terminology, OSHA standards, and ABS standards
- Must pass SMAW 6G Pipe Test to become ABS Certified
